CAPTAL® is a high purity synthetic Hydroxylapatite having a very similar composition to that of the mineral content in human bone. It is thermally stable to 1300ºC in air, retaining a highly crystalline structure.

The powder manufactured by PBL can be processed into different products; Dense Ceramic, Microporous Ceramic, Macroporous Ceramic, Foam Block and Composites.

Research is being undertaken at several Universities using these substrates to culture Human Osteblast cells (HOB) for tissue engineering experiments.
